Dorothy Maud Milbourn
Birth 7 Jan 1930
Philadelphia, Pennsylvania, USA
Death 2 Apr 2021 (aged 91)
Tyler, Smith County, Texas, USA
Burial Rose Hill Cemetery
Tyler, Smith County, Texas, USA
Dorothy Maud Milbourn Reuland died April 2, 2021 peacefully in her sleep at home. She was born January 7, 1930 in Philadelphia, PA, the second daughter of Frederick and Josephine Milbourn but lived most of her life in Tyler.
She raised her five children here and built a home and a life in East Texas with her family and many friends.
Dottie, as her friends called her, was a longtime member of Immaculate Conception Church.
She was preceded in death by her parents and sister, Gwen Gorman, as well as her loving husband, John J. Reuland, who died in 1995.
Since that time, she occupied herself keeping in touch with her children, grandchildren, and great-grandchildren. She enjoyed shopping excursions with her many granddaughters and loved nothing more than giving to her family.
Dottie is survived by a daughter, Leigh Lowell and her husband, David of Midland; son, John of Tyler, son, Robert of Fort Lauderdale, FL, daughter, Lauren Creasman and husband Scott of The Woodlands, and son, Kurt and wife, Sherri Reuland of Whitehouse, as well as eight granddaughters, one grandson, and three great-grandchildren. | Milbourn, Dorothy Maude "Dottie" (I8611)

Eugene Bernard McGough
Birth23 January 1931
Death 22 Oct 2022 (aged 90–91)
Burial Holy Sepulchre Cemetery
Cheltenham, Pennsylvania, USA
Memorial ID: 245064425
Eugene B. McGough Jr. of Warminster passed away on October 22, 2022.
He was 91 years old. Eugene was born in the Mt. Airy section of Philadelphia, PA to the late Eugene and Marjorie McGough.
He is preceded in death by his wife Patricia Conway McGough and his child Eugene. Eugene is survived by his children Maureen McGough, and Patricia Mann (Ed) and his grandchildren Eddie Mann (Allison), Meghan Mann, and Shannon Mann.
Eugene is also preceded in death by his wife Helene Laczko McGough and is survived by her children Michael Laczko, Daniel Laczko (Shyre), Nancy Flanagan (Robert), Carol Bigham (Ronald), and Susan Lombardi (Richard), and grandchildren Jennifer Laczko, Steven Laczko, Kelley Terrell-Green, Shalynn Flanagan, Sean Flanagan, Jessica Bigham Geist, James Lombardi, and Krista Lombardi.
Eugene graduated from St. John's in Manayunk and attended Drexel University. He worked for PennDot for many years, a couple of other engineering firms, and then started his own engineering firm. He ended his career as the Warminster Township Manager in the early 1990s.
Eugene had a passion for volunteering and was President of the St. Vincent DePaul Society, Philadelphia Chapter, President of the American Red Cross, Philadelphia Chapter, and President of the Board of Warminster Ambulance Corps and a member for over 40 years.
He also had a passion for politics and was active in Philadelphia politics prior their move to Warminster, was an elected Centennial School Board Director, managed election campaigns in Warminster and was Committeeman while at Ann's Choice.
Eugene was involved in numerous religious activities and was a member of the Pastoral Council at Nativity of Our Lord parish, a Eucharistic Minister at Ann's Choice, and led the Eucharistic Ministers' organization at Ann's Choice for several years.
Eugene had many interests and hobbies including spending time at what he considered his second home in Wildwood, being a pilot in his 20s, a lifeguard in the 1940's, a member of the VFW post in Warminster, and developed a passion for genealogy later in his life. | McGough, Eugene Bernard Jr (I12975)
